Have you noticed how retro styles are making a major comeback in today’s design and fashion scenes? It’s like stepping into a time machine, where elements from the 90s and Y2K eras are front and center. One of the most exciting aspects of this revival is how you can blend vintage color palettes with nostalgic graphic designs to create bold, eye-catching looks. These vintage color palettes feature vivid neons, pastel shades, and earthy tones that were iconic in those decades. Mixing these colors allows you to craft outfits and designs that feel fresh yet familiar, tapping into the playful and rebellious spirit of the era.

Nostalgic graphic designs further anchor this retro aesthetic. Think bold, pixelated logos, geometric patterns, and whimsical illustrations that scream early internet vibes. Incorporating these elements into your fashion choices or creative projects instantly transports you back to a time when digital graphics were just beginning to explode. For example, you might wear a hoodie with a pixel art mascot or use graphic tees featuring retro band logos or cartoon characters. These designs aren’t just nostalgic; they’re statement pieces that add personality and a sense of fun to your look.

You’ll find that retro aesthetics thrive on the juxtaposition of old and new. Vintage color palettes serve as a foundation, giving your style a genuine retro feel. When paired with modern cuts and fabrics, you get a fresh take that doesn’t feel outdated. For instance, a classic pastel windbreaker or a neon-accented accessory instantly elevates your outfit with a nostalgic punch. Meanwhile, incorporating nostalgic graphic designs into your accessories—like pins, patches, or phone cases—can tie the whole look together without overwhelming it. How Do I Mix 90S and Y2K Styles Authentically?

To mix 90s and Y2K styles authentically, focus on blending key elements from fashion history and cultural influences. Combine baggy jeans, crop tops, and chunky sneakers with metallic fabrics, holographic accessories, and low-rise silhouettes. You can also add neon colors and tech-inspired details. Keep the look balanced by mixing casual and flashy pieces, so the styles feel cohesive and true to their era origins.

What Accessories Best Capture the Retro Aesthetic?

To capture the retro aesthetic, you should choose statement accessories like bold jewelry, chunky belts, and colorful scrunchies. Statement sunglasses are essential—think oversized frames or tinted lenses that scream 90s or Y2K. Don’t shy away from quirky hair clips or neon accents. These pieces instantly elevate your look, making it authentic and fun. Mix and match to reflect that playful, nostalgic vibe.

Can Retro Fashion Be Sustainable and Eco-Friendly?

Yes, retro fashion can be sustainable and eco-friendly. You can choose clothes made from sustainable fabrics like organic cotton, recycled polyester, or Tencel. Look for eco-conscious brands that prioritize ethical production and eco-friendly materials. By selecting vintage pieces or upcycling garments, you reduce waste and lessen your environmental impact. What Are Some Budget-Friendly Ways to Achieve Retro Looks?

You can achieve retro looks on a budget by DIY styling your outfits with simple customizations, like distressing jeans or adding patches. Thrift shopping is also a great way to find authentic vintage pieces without spending much. Mix and match thrifted items with modern basics to create a unique, budget-friendly retro vibe. Don’t be afraid to experiment with accessories and layered looks to really capture that nostalgic feel.
